Tim Scott mocked for over-the-top Trump event speech: ‘An SNL cold open’
AI Summary

Senator Tim Scott faced criticism on social media for an animated and intense speech delivered at a GOP convention in Texas. Commentators and political rivals mocked the performance, comparing it to an SNL sketch or a caricature of a preacher.
